Responsibilities

  • Monitoring the wafer fabrication equipment and respond to issues
  • Qualifying new manufacturing equipment
  • Coordinating the scheduling of equipment qualifications and equipment down time with manufacturing
  • Utilizing software to analyze data, identify trends to make decisions about processing product.
  • Adjusting equipment parameters as needed when exceeded and monitors process parameters when tools return from maintenance.
  • Executing in line changes (CPM) to the process or equipment.
  • Communicating technical information within the department through presentations.
  • Continuously revising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)
  • Developing improved processes to increase capability.
  • Monitoring operations costs and develop cost reduction projects
